Falsification in Math vs Science?

Mathematics can’t be falsified because that’s not what the mathematics does. Mathematics is just the set of rules for manipulating formalisms, some of which correspond to the real world, and some of which don’t. Science is the process of figuring out what in the real world corresponds to the math.

Does science work by falsification?

The Falsification Principle, proposed by Karl Popper, is a way of demarcating science from non-science. It suggests that for a theory to be considered scientific it must be able to be tested and conceivably proven false. For example, the hypothesis that “all swans are white,” can be falsified by observing a black swan.

What does falsification in science mean?

Falsifiability is the capacity for some proposition, statement, theory or hypothesis to be proven wrong. That capacity is an essential component of the scientific method and hypothesis testing. In a scientific context, falsifiability is sometimes considered synonymous with testability.

Why is falsifiability so important to science?

A theory or hypothesis is falsifiable (or refutable) if it can be logically contradicted by an empirical test that can potentially be executed with existing technologies. The purpose of falsifiability, even being a logical criterion, is to make the theory predictive and testable, thus useful in practice.

What is scientific falsifiability?

criterion of falsifiability, in the philosophy of science, a standard of evaluation of putatively scientific theories, according to which a theory is genuinely scientific only if it is possible in principle to establish that it is false.

What is the difference between falsification and fabrication?

(1) Fabrication is making up data or results and recording or reporting them. (2) Falsification is manipulating research materials, equipment, or processes, or changing or omitting data or results such that the research is not accurately represented in the research record.

Is a scientific theory a guess?

In everyday use, the word “theory” often means an untested hunch, or a guess without supporting evidence. But for scientists, a theory has nearly the opposite meaning. A theory is a well-substantiated explanation of an aspect of the natural world that can incorporate laws, hypotheses and facts.

Why is falsifiability important in psychology?

Falsifiability is an important feature of science. It is the principle that a proposition or theory could only be considered scientific if in principle it was possible to establish it as false. One of the criticisms of some branches of psychology, e.g. Freud’s theory, is that they lack falsifiability.

Which is the best example of an operational definition?

An Operational Definition is the definition of a variable in terms of the operations or techniques used to measure or manipulate it. Examples: –“Height” as defined by the number of feet/inches a person is tall.

What is the meaning of independent and dependent variables?

Researchers often manipulate or measure independent and dependent variables in studies to test cause-and-effect relationships. The independent variable is the cause. Its value is independent of other variables in your study. The dependent variable is the effect. Its value depends on changes in the independent variable.
